New report will show number of empty homes well above 300,000... With so much vacant property about, councils are now actively seeking homes to rent from a minimum of 10 years for those on waiting lists... A REPORT being finalised by planners at UCD for publication this month is expected to conclude that the number of empty houses or apartments in the State may be even higher than the 302,625 figure suggested recently by their colleagues in NUI Maynooth. Dr Brendan Williams, lead author of the UCD report, told The Irish Times that “our figures might be higher”. He had also visited some uncompleted housing estates last weekend and they painted a “bleak picture” of the current levels of vacant housing. The 300,000-plus figure, calculated by the Maynooth-based National Institute of Regional and Spatial Analysis (Nirsa), took a lot of people by surprise – especially as the Construction Industry Federation had been sticking to a vacancy rate of around 40,000.
